TESTOSTERON

by Tomasz Konecki, Andrzej Saramonowicz

synopsis

A wedding party after a marriage ceremony that did not take place because the bride ran away from the altar. The abandoned groom is supported by a group of six equally disoriented guys. Their meeting turns into a crazy series of fights, discussions, toasts, surprising new turns of action and shocking discoveries in the area of male-female relationships. Will they succeed in finding out what the real desires of women are? And what love is guided by: reason, feelings or - perhaps... biology?

international title: Testosteron
original title: Testosteron
country: Poland
year: 2007
genre: fiction
directed by: Tomasz Konecki, Andrzej Saramonowicz
screenplay: Andrzej Saramonowicz
cast: Piotr Adamczyk, Borys Szyc, Maciej Stuhr, Krzysztof Stelmaszyk, Cezary Kosiński, Tomasz Karolak, Tomasz Kot, Mirosława Olbińska
cinematography by: Tomasz Madejski
film editing: Jarosław Barzan
art director: Przemysław Kowalski
costumes designer: Jan Kozikowski
music: Misza Hairulin
producer: Iwona Ogonowska-Konecka
production: Van Worden Sp. z o. o.
distributor: ITI Cinema
